I will be using Windows Vista Home Premium 32 bit with SP1 and all updates with User Account Control turned on. The browser will be IE7 running in Protected Mode. The security software will be Windows Live OneCare with current updates and all security features will be enabled.

If it tries to install any software then Windows Vista will squawk like a chicken about it. I'm 99.99% certain that it is all web based and doesn't require any software.

Somethings must be manually configured before and after going to the website. This is not like the other online process or using the CD where it holds the user's hand and does everything automatically for the user.

I have heard on this forum that the modems are already configured with the attreg.att.net user name and attreg password. I have done several of these lately with New in the Box 2210-02-1006 ADSL2+ Gateways and 3347-02-1006L ADSL2+ Wireless Gateways and this is not the case. There was no user name and password in these modems.

I ordered the $10.00 FastAccess DSL Lite deal for this guy and he did not qualify for the free modem so I will be giving him a used 2210-02-1006 modem that I will fully reset back to factory defaults.
